Magnetic separation is used to separate non magnetic material from magnetic material by using magnetism to attract magnetic material from a solids mixture To do this a magnetic field is used to exert force on magnetic particles attracting them to the magnet

Magnetic separation is a physical separation process that utilizes the differences in magnetic properties of various materials to separate them from one another It is commonly used in the mining and recycling industries to isolate valuable magnetic materials such as iron from non magnetic waste improving the efficiency of resource recovery and material processing

·Magnetic separation is a method to recover magnetic materials by magnetism difference between particles which is mostly applied in the field of mineral processing and is cleaner and cheaper than other methods such as flotation [[1] [2]] According to the media water or air magnetic separation can be divided into wet and dry types
